Page 2: Caguas:

• It is the largest city in the Eastern region of Puerto Rico and it is

located 12 miles south of San Juan. It is set at the crossroads of

the main highways connecting the north and the south, and the

center to the east of the Island.

• It is located in the largest valley of Puerto Rico surrounded by

two mountain ranges, a rainforest and 4 rivers.

• Caguas has evolved as a major tourist destination offering a

distinct true Puerto Rican Creole (“Criollo”) Cultural experience.

• Caguas represents the “Criollo” ...the true Puerto Rican

identity. A fusion of three ethnic roots, Taíno, Spanish and

African, which is different from the “Spanish” identity of San

Juan.

• To showcase the Puerto Rican Creole Identity, the City has

developed a series of events, activities, monuments and

tourist attractions.… It is a living museum!

• It is the home of: The Caguas Botanical and Cultural Garden

William Miranda Marín; The Route of the Creole Heart: a

historic and cultural urban trail featuring twelve stops that

shows what it means to be uniquely Puerto Rican; the Four

Points Caguas Real Hotel and Casino: with the largest casino

on the Island; the Caguas Real Golf Course with18 holes; the

San Salvador Rain Forest Adventure among many other

recreational and tourist attractions.

• The Caguas Botanical & Cultural Garden

is a unique display of animal and plant life,

and architecture dating back to the mid

1800s.

• It is home to ruins of the Hacienda San

José sugar cane processing facility as

well as to the remains of a large

indigenous village.
